Now I'm on the my fuel pressure. It has a gauge at the fuel rail. I haven't touched it till now. Before it read 40 vaccum on engine off. At idle, engine on, it shoots up to 80. When I took the vaccum off, engine on, to adjust the FPR & lower the pressure. The gauge didn't move from 80. I had to almost back the whole screw out & it only dropped to around 50. So when I screwed it back in to where it was, it only went back up to 65. Which I thought was odd???
So now I'm stuck here. I'm thinking the gauge could be bad. It does have a crack in the glass. Was gonna go to Pep Boys to see if they sell any there. But suggestions would be helpful. Also, I havnt changed the fuel filter yet. Still need to go get some pipe wrenches. So that could be it as well. I don't think the previous owner changed it in a long... time.
